One of the things that I think was done in absolute perfection was Gollum's torment and the war between Gollum and Smeagol. I think Jackson/Wood/Boyens/Serkis pulled out the dynamics of what the Ring did and was doing to Gollum and Frodo. I saw not parallels, but a megareflection of what sin does to the soul and the kind of tortures that sin exacts upon us.
The fact that audience members were actually laughing at some of Gollum's conflict scenes was almost as hurtful as watching Gollum get tricked by Frodo and Faramir.
Obviously people who have never confronted their own souls.
